Exclusive: Sunshine Stars Set To Beat Enyimba To Signature Of Dream Team Star Stanley Dimgba
Published: February 10, 2016
Allnigeriasoccer.com understands that Nigeria U23 international Stanley Dimgba is in advanced talks with Sunshine Stars over a contract ahead of the start of the season.
The exciting winger played for Warri Wolves last term but has decided to leave the Delta State club for pastures new because they were unable to meet their financial obligations to him as and when due.
Stanley Dimgba’s representative and Sunshine Stars are at the negotiation table, with the Owena Waves suits offering him a two-year deal, but the player does not want to commit his future to the Akure side for more than twelve months.
NPFL champs Enyimba had made contact with the 22-year-old but he rejected their overtures before he started training with Sunshine Stars.
Dimgba was a member of the Dream Team VI squad that won the Africa U23 Cup of Nations in Senegal two months back.
